News: Government redraw their dietary guidelines

Sustain has welcomed Public Health England's new Eatwell guide, which has removed junk food as "not an essential part of a balanced diet". It is also the first time that the guidance has considred its impact on sustainability.

News: Courtauld 2025: reducing the resources needed for food

Courtauld 2025 is a voluntary agreement for the whole food chain that aims to reduce the resources needed to provide food and drink by one-fifth in 10 years. There is still time to sign up or join the Steering Group, prior to launch on 15 March.

News: Young people to be trained to glean and cook surplus food

Food waste specialists Feedback and FoodCycle are teaming up to train over 4,000 young people to reclaim surplus food through gleaning and to cook this food for vulnerable people.
